Summary: Organizations in The Visual Era
Review: Having had first hand experience as an IT Manager of a company that embodies the Visual Management concept, I can enthusiastically recommend this book for anyone wanting to improve the performance of an organization. Seeing is Believing delivers a new, practical, and doable approach to improved productivity in an environment that simultaneously recognizes its employees.
Visual management may at first seem as simple as adding some office decor and leaving it at that. But the authors are quick to point out that an office that looks good is not the primary goal. The primary goal is an office that performs well. This book provides some excellent suggestions on how to achieve this goal through the alignment of an organization's mission and vision with its management infrastructure in the simplest and most effective manner known - through visuals.
I particularly liked the concepts presented to recognize the workforce, including the posting of photographs and graphics of employees and their family members. This type of recognition boosts morale on a daily basis and helps to make all employees truly feel part of the organization.
Liff and Posey have added some visual soul to a field that's been searching for a more modern approach. Read this book and you will learn how to add this soul to your organization's management and get it on the road to being a top performer.
